Success of Long-acting Anti-inflammatories After Anterior Cruciate Ligament and Meniscal Injury
RandomizedParallel-groupQuadruple-blindTreatment
Summary
The purpose of this study is to determine if extended-release triamcinolone acetonide treatment alters the progressive changes in bone shape previously demonstrated after anterior cruciate ligament (ACL) reconstruction with partial meniscectomy or meniscal repair.
